Profile

Adj Asst Prof Kinjal Mehta is a Senior Consultant & Director of Foot and Ankle Surgery with Department of Orthopaedic Surgery, Changi General Hospital (CGH). Under Dr Kinjal Mehta, the service has been brought to greater heights and multiple initiatives and collaborations to improve the service have been implemented. Multidisciplinary care is undertaken to ensure optimal outcomes for patients.

Dr Kinjal Mehta graduated from National University of Singapore and did her Orthopaedic Surgery training in Singapore. Dr Kinjal underwent Foot and Ankle fellowship training in Canada under Dr Mark Glazebrook in 2015.

Dr Kinjal is Deputy Vice Chair (Research) of Musculoskeletal Academic Clinical Programme. She works with other key stakeholders to improve research avenues within SingHealth cluster. She is passionate about research and attends conferences on a regular basis to present her research. She has been invited as faculty in local and regional workshops, conferences and webinars.

Dr Kinjal is active in teaching medical students from various medical schools in Singapore. She is part of core faculty for Orthopaedic residency teaching. She organises foot and ankle cadaveric course regularly to enhance the learning and surgical skills of junior doctors. Due to her commitment to education, Dr Kinjal won the Changi General Hospital Best Educator Award 2022 – the Guru.
